What Factors Should You Consider When Selecting a 6 Pack of 8 Volt Golf Cart Batteries?
When selecting a 6 pack of 8 Volt golf cart batteries, consider compatibility, capacity, lifespan, maintenance, and brand reputation.
- Compatibility
- Capacity
- Lifespan
- Maintenance
- Brand Reputation
Understanding these factors will help you make an informed decision about the best 8 Volt golf cart batteries for your needs.
-
Compatibility:
Compatibility refers to the ability of the battery to work effectively with your specific golf cart model. Each golf cart may have specific requirements for battery size and type. It is essential to check the manufacturer’s specifications to ensure the batteries you select will fit and perform efficiently in your cart. -
Capacity:
Capacity indicates how much energy a battery can store and is usually measured in amp-hours (Ah). Higher capacity results in longer run time before needing a recharge. For golf cart batteries, a common capacity range is between 170 Ah to 225 Ah. Choosing a battery with suitable capacity ensures that your golf cart meets your travel needs. -
Lifespan:
Lifespan refers to the total period a battery can be used before it needs replacement. Golf cart batteries typically have a lifespan ranging from 3 to 7 years, depending on usage and maintenance. Regular charging and proper care can extend battery life. Manufacturers often provide warranties that can help gauge expected longevity. -
Maintenance:
Maintenance pertains to the care required to keep the batteries in optimal condition. Some batteries are maintenance-free, while others require regular water topping and cleaning. Understanding the maintenance needs can affect your overall ownership experience. Selecting maintenance-free options can save time and effort. -
Brand Reputation:
Brand reputation plays a crucial role in selecting reliable batteries. Well-established brands often provide better quality, customer service, and warranty options. Research user reviews and professional recommendations to choose reputable brands known for their performance and durability.

What Maintenance Practices Ensure Longevity for 8 Volt Golf Cart Batteries?
To ensure longevity for 8 volt golf cart batteries, proper maintenance practices are essential. These practices include regularly checking water levels, using a suitable charger, maintaining clean terminals, and ensuring proper storage.
- Regularly check water levels
- Use a suitable charger
- Maintain clean terminals
- Ensure proper storage
- Monitor battery voltage
- Avoid deep discharging
- Perform equalization charging
Understanding these maintenance practices is vital for extending the lifespan of your 8 volt golf cart batteries.
-
Regularly Check Water Levels: Regularly check water levels in the battery cells to ensure adequate electrolyte levels. Each cell should be filled to the appropriate level using distilled water. Insufficient water can lead to battery damage and decreased performance. Keeping the levels in check can add several years to battery life.
-
Use a Suitable Charger: Using the correct charger for 8 volt batteries is crucial. Chargers designed for lead-acid batteries prevent overcharging and maintain proper voltage levels. Overcharging can cause excessive gas release and may lead to battery freeze in colder conditions. Many manufacturers recommend specific chargers for optimal performance.
-
Maintain Clean Terminals: Ensure battery terminals are clean and free from corrosion. Corrosion can increase resistance and reduce performance. Cleaning terminals with a mixture of baking soda and water can help maintain the electrical connection. Proper connections ensure effective power transfer to the golf cart.
-
Ensure Proper Storage: Store batteries in a cool, dry place when not in use. High temperatures can accelerate battery wear, while cold temperatures can reduce capacity. Ideally, batteries should be stored in areas where the temperature remains stable and falls within the manufacturer’s recommended range.
-
Monitor Battery Voltage: Regular monitoring of battery voltage can prevent over-discharge. Batteries should maintain a minimum voltage to perform effectively. Use a multimeter or a dedicated battery monitor to keep track of the voltage levels. This practice ensures timely recharging and avoids deep discharge situations.
-
Avoid Deep Discharging: Avoid running the golf cart until the batteries are fully discharged. Deep discharging can significantly shorten their lifespan. Aim to recharge the batteries when they reach about 50% of their capacity. This practice helps maintain the health of the batteries over time.
-
Perform Equalization Charging: Equalization charging is a controlled overcharge that balances the voltage of each battery cell. This process prevents stratification of the electrolyte and allows for better performance. It is recommended every 30-60 cycles but should be performed according to the manufacturer’s guidelines to avoid overcharging risk.
